Speaker is a Justice of the Supreme Court of Ghana.
-
He hails from Isa, a village in the Upper West
-
region of Ghana. He is the fourth of seven children
-
of his mother. He entered the University of Ghana where
-
he was awarded his Bachelor of Law degree, tained and
-
became a barrister at law. He holds a Master of
-
Arts degree MA in International Security and Civil Military Relations
-
from the Naval Postgraduate School in Monterey, California, United States.
-
He later founded his own law firm, where he worked
-
as the firm's managing partner until his appointment to the bench.
-
As a lawyer, his areas of expertise included investments, securities,
-
commercial law, criminal law, and litigation. He is a fellow
-
of the inaugural class of the Africa Leadership Initiative West
-
Africa and a member of the Aspen Global Leadership Network.
-
He also served as an examiner at the Ghana School
-
of Law. He was sworn into office on Tuesday, twenty
-
sixth May twenty twenty. He became the first Ghanaian from
-
the Upper Way region to be appointed to serve on
-
Goda's highest Court of jurisdiction. His appointment also now makes
-
him a part of a small group of persons who
-
were called to the Supreme Court bench directly from the bar.
-
He is a Christian, married and a father of four children. Bishops, Pastors,
